Leading Electric Car Manufacturer Tesla has launched its Fast Car Charging in Berlin, Germany this week. The charger is aimed to target cities to attract more customers into Electric Cars.
The “V3 Charger” enables the Tesla Model 3 cars to be charged enough in 5 mins to go up to 120kms. Tesla is really changing the market and concept of electric cars.
The company has aimed to add at least one more inner-city fast charging site in Germany within 2020. The main aim is to eliminate the hindrance of charging caused to people. This would
ultimately change the mindset of people away from traditional cars to electric cars. This move is aimed by Tesla to create a new customer base.
However, the company still believes in slow residential charging and would continue to work its way to assert its dominance.
